RUTH MACAXV Coordinator Tests and Guidance Class Counselor - Senior Miss Magaw is a native Californian, born in Los Angeles. She attended UCLA and USC, receiving her BA and MA degrees, and majoring in English. Her favorite pastime is traveling. She has been at Montebello Senior High since 1942, and greatly enjoys working with the staff and students. HOWVARD RUPARD Coordinator Vocational Guidance Class Counselor - junior VVhittier College and USC are the colleges Mr. Rupard attended, al- though he was born in Kansas City, Missouri. Sports and reading occupy much of his free time. He has been at MHS for six years and likes the norderly, clean campus, fine student body spirit, and the good aca- demic reputation. counselors JAMES DILLON Coordinator of Special Activities Class Counselor - Sophomore Oak Park, Illinois is Mr. Dillon's birth place. He received his BA and MA degrees from Pomona and U S C. VVoodworking, cooking, camping, tra- vel, and reading are his pastimes. He has been at MHS for seven years and likes the school because of the friendly students, cooperative facul- ty, and pleasant atmospheref' jANET XV OOD Coordinator of Special Activities Class Counselor - junior Mrs. Mlood was born in La Habra, California, and graduated from XVhit- tier College. Her favorite pastimes arc cooking, gardening, and hiking. She has been at Montebello since 1945 and uthe loyalty of students and faculty of MHS and the feeling of teamwork among all phases of school lifev is liked best by Mrs. XVood.

Dr. Wlhinnery, before becoming superin- tendent of schools in 1949, had served as Principal of MHS and Director of Adult Education. He received his BA from UCLA, his MA from Occidental College, and his EdD from USC.
